>> Patch 7.1.295
>> Problem: Vimtutor only works with vim, not gvim.
>> Solution: Add the -g flag to vimtutor. (Dominique Pelle) Add gvimtutor.
>> Files: src/Makefile, src/gvimtutor, src/vimtutor,
>> runtime/doc/vimtutor.1
